When her two best friends forget her birthday, crushing her, Jess is amazed when one of the infamous Pride brothers shows up, apparently wanting nothing more than to sweep her off her feet. Jezebel’s life will never be the same, and though she is sure the relationship is only temporary, Jezebel embraces the attention Brandon showers on her.
Brandon has found his mate. He is overjoyed, his lion content, but then he suddenly finds all is not easy in love, at least not when you are a lion shifter with a human mate totally unaware of the paranormal world. Now, Brandon must not only reveal the existence of shifters to his mate, but also tell her of the very real threat they fight against.
Will Jezebel be able to accept everything that comes with being a shifter’s mate? Or will the truth be too much, sending her running back to the familiar, safe harbor of the human world?

Jezebel "Jess" is devastated when her two best friends forget her birthday. One is more preoccupied with lusting over a girl who is taken, and the other is lost in his own thoughts. When they get invited to a party, Jess decides to wallow in the booze that is available and forget how hurt she is. When Brandon arrives though she can't help but be briefly mesmerized by the handsome man, but Jess knows he would never give her full figured self another look.
Jess couldn't be more wrong, Brandon sees Jess and knows she is her mate. The only problem in his way is she is human and knows nothing of their shifter ways.
I was a bit torn on this one, I liked the story overall and it had some very unexpected twists. The issue I was torn up about is she is eighteen and still in highschool, granted she is of age so that is out there but I wished she had been like 20. Maybe if I did not have kids around the same age it wouldn't have bothered me as much because I am old fuddy duddy, but I will say the story is handled with care. Brandon is fantastic, he is sweet and so protective of her you know she is wonderful. Overall excellent read.
Everything that didn't quite work for me in the first book of this series, the over the top possessive hero, the woman who's human and his intended mate and their age difference were all better done here. In fact it was just better all round. I liked the characters more, the chemistry between Brandon and Jess was far more potent and passionate. The other characters I liked as well but especially Jess's two friends Zeke and Travis, I liked the little twist with them. I'm looking forward to the next book.
What happens in Vegas, stays in Vegas except when your the mate of a Pride shifter.
What better setting for a sexy shifter romance than the city of sin itself. Apart from the romance I find the creatures that shifters fight such as goblins and leprachauns an exciting addition to this fun series. The author has their own spin on these creatures and even the shifters themselves that make them unique. While I love the bit of action we get to see, the thing that really makes these books shine is the amount of drama and sexy shifters that get packed into the pages.
The heroine Jezebel is a very relatable character. She is not perfect by any means, but rather than dwell on this fact she does her best to live life to the fullest. She also doesn't let the ignorance of others get her down. I really admire her kindness and courage so it is easy to see how Brandon could so easily fall for her. The best part was getting to see the growth in Jezebel throughout the book. At first she was a bit insecure and although she didn't take crap from anyone else she still didn't believe she would ever deserve someone like Brandon. By the end she knew that she deserved all that and more just like everyone else and let those who said otherwise know it. I couldn't have been more proud.
Brandon is a sweet and patient man who knew what he wanted and went after it. I loved how caring he was and that he always let Jezebel know how beautiful she was and never let her get down on herself. He cherished and protected her, what more could a woman want. He wasn't perfect by any means, but a bit of growly possessiveness from your very on alpha isn't so bad.
The heat rating on this book is through the roof and if a smokin hot romance is what your after look no further than "Jezebel's Lion".
